Death is going to come sooner or later. Before death comes, learn how to die in meditation.
The inevitability of death is a fundamental truth that each individual must confront, often accompanied by fear and uncertainty. Meditation offers a profound means to prepare for this transition, transforming fear into personal growth and spiritual development. By focusing the mind and experiencing profound stillness, meditation allows one to glimpse the nature of consciousness beyond the transient ego and physical body.
In meditation, learning to “die” means letting go of attachments and identifications, revealing a more expansive aspect of our being. This practice helps one face death with equanimity and insight, cultivating inner peace and acceptance. Familiarity with letting go in meditation can make the transition of physical death more serene.
Moreover, meditative practice encourages living fully and authentically in the present moment. Recognising the fleeting nature of each moment enhances appreciation for life and fosters compassion and mindfulness in interactions with others.
In essence, learning to die in meditation is not just about preparing for death but embracing life more fully. This practice nurtures empathy and transforms the fear of death into a catalyst for a meaningful, purposeful life.
